brands are billion-dollar sellers‚ including Always‚ Braun‚ Crest‚ Fusion‚ Gillette‚ Head & Shoulders‚ Mach3‚ Olay‚ Oral-B‚ Pantene‚ and Wella in the beauty and grooming segment‚ as well as Bounty‚ Charmin‚ Dawn‚ Downy‚ Duracell‚ Gain‚ Iams‚ Pampers‚ and Tide in the household care segment. P&G’s hundreds of brands are available in more than 180 countries. P&G’s accomplishments over the past 173 years have come from successfully orchestrating the myriad factors that contribute to market

Proctor & Gamble (P&G) has seen the bullwhip effect in case of supply chain of Pampers diapers‚ which caused increase in cost and more and more tedious to cope up supply with demand in market. Procter & Gamble (P&G) examined the order patterns for one of their best-selling products‚ Pampers. Its sales at retail stores were fluctuating‚ but the variabilities were certainly not excessive.
